Response from The Affordable Plumber
When trying to find a reason for low water pressure, it is always best to start at the source. In this case, it would be the water line to the house. We dug the first hole to see if there was a pressure release valve by the meter, and we dug the second hole to discover a dropped gate valve. This means the valve was partially closed, restricting the flow into the house, causing reduced pressure. We were able to resolve the pressure issue throughout the house, with the exception of the kitchen faucet. Upon checking the kitchen faucet, we discovered that the cartridge inside the faucet was faulty and needed to be replaced. The only way this can be done, is to order from the manufacturers website. Businesses are not allowed to order from the site, only the person who owns the faucet is allowed to order. It requires a copy of a receipt for proof of purchase. We instructed the homeowner on how to go to the website and order the replacement part, and offered to install it for a very nominal fee when it arrived if they wanted. The customer said they would take care of ordering the part, and call us back. The customer never had any negative comments at the time the service was being provided, and we did our best to explain each step and why it was being done.
